Default Anyone Know Anything About SAV?

I got selected for SAV pending PEPC, academy, etc. I was wondering if anyone knew anything about SAV (Savannah International) and would share their information with me? Does anyone here work or has worked at SAV?

Basics that I have read:
2 runways
18 hour facility
newly built tower
roughly 300 operations a day

They border our airspace to the south. I have visited the facility a few times. From what I understand, the working relationship between the controllers and management is pretty good compared to elsewhere in the FAA.

They have some restricted areas and MOAs that go active usually daily which gums up the works a bit. My understanding of it is that everything south of the Rwy 9 extended centerline is unusable as well as the airspace west of the Rwy 36 extended centerline when those areas are active. Excessive coordination with adjacent facilities is a problem.

SAV is overall responsible for HXD arrivals and departures, but since that airport is on the boundary between NBC and SAV airspace extensive coordination is required with NBC approach. (NBC usually works HXD Rwy 21 arrivals and SAV works Rwy 3.)

Good pay for the amount of traffic worked.
